In Episode 95 of Spirit Outspoken, host Taylor Perkins explores the profound idea that separation from God, others, and ourselves is an illusion. Drawing from diverse
Key takeaways
- The illusion of separation from God, others, and ourselves is at the root of fear and spiritual searching.
- Divine reality is non-linear; past, present, and future coexist in the eternal now.
Main topics
- The illusion of separation in spirituality
- Unity across religious traditions (Christianity, Hinduism, Mayan cosmology)
Notable quotes
"The moment you put a box around it, it's already fragmenting its expression."
"You do not become one with something. You do not ascend to oneness. It's not something you achieve. The oneness has always been there."
